X/2 + 3/2 < 5/2 give solution ​

Start with


(x)/(2)+(3)/(2)<(5)/(2)

Multiply the whole equation by 2. Since 2 is positive, we don't need to switch the inequality sign:


x+3<5

Subtract 3 from both sides:


x<2
